
Where to Register a U.S. Company in Wyoming-and How to Set Up a Branch Office: A Step-by-Step Guide
Wyoming has long maintained high visibility in the field of U.S. company formation-not by chance. Its absence of a state-level corporate income tax, exemption from franchise tax, non-disclosure of shareholder and director information to the public, and streamlined annual reporting process collectively constitute the core practical advantages driving its frequent selection. Yet establishing a U.S. branch is far more complex than simply “filling out a registration form.” It involves multiple hands-on steps-including entity structuring, regulatory alignment, bank account opening, and ongoing compliance maintenance.

Why Wyoming-Not Another State?
First, no state-level corporate income tax: Wyoming imposes no corporate income tax on businesses, regardless of whether their income originates within or outside the state.
Second, no franchise tax-a key distinction from states such as California and Delaware, where companies must pay fixed fees based on authorized capital stock or asset value.
Third, stable and mature registered agent services: Wyoming permits remote appointment of licensed local agents statewide to receive statutory correspondence on behalf of the company.
Fourth, flexible corporate governance structure: A single individual may serve simultaneously as director, officer, and shareholder; formal meetings and minutes are not required.
Critical Structural Considerations Prior to Registration
1. Clarify entity type: Choose between an LLC (Limited Liability Company) and a C-Corporation. An LLC offers pass-through taxation and liability protection, whereas a C-Corp better supports future fundraising or public listing.
2. Assess operational substance: If you plan to conduct physical operations in the U.S., hire local employees, or hold assets domestically, you must also consider foreign qualification in relevant states and potential sales tax registration obligations.

Plan ahead for bank account opening: Most U.S. banks require, post-registration, an EIN (Employer Identification Number), certified formation documents, organizational bylaws or operating agreement, and a Beneficial Ownership Statement. Some institutions further require in-person or video-based identity verification.
Core Steps to Establish a Branch Office
1. Select and engage a registered agent, obtaining their signed “Acceptance of Appointment” letter;
2. File either a Certificate of Organization (for an LLC) or a Certificate of Incorporation (for a C-Corp) with the Wyoming Secretary of State, including the company name, registered office address, and manager/director information;
3. Upon issuance of the state-issued Certificate of Formation/Incorporation, apply for an EIN with the IRS via Form SS-4 (online submission available);
4. Draft internal governance documents: An LLC must adopt an Operating Agreement; a C-Corp must adopt Bylaws and adopt initial Board resolutions;
5. Open a corporate bank account-note that certain banks require a U.S. physical mailing address and at least one authorized signatory to appear in person at a branch location.
Post-Formation Compliance Requirements You Cannot Overlook
1. File an Annual Report each year, due on the last day of the month following the original registration month. Filing fees are $60 for LLCs and $50 for C-Corps.
2. Maintain an active, valid registered agent. Any change of registered office address must be reported to the Secretary of State within 30 days.
3. If generating U.S.-source income, file federal-and potentially state-level-tax returns, even if reporting zero income or zero tax liability.
4. Non-resident alien members of an LLC should carefully assess withholding tax obligations related to FDAP (Fixed, Determinable, Annual, or Periodic) or ECI (Effectively Connected Income) payments to avoid unexpected tax liabilities upon cross-border disbursements.
